1. A tissue collection device, comprising:

  • an elongate body, having a proximal end, a closed distal end, and an open inner lumen;

    a control on the proximal end of the body;

    a cutting tip on the distal end of the body, the cutting tip comprising a slit extending in a proximal direction from the closed distal end, the slit dividing the cutting tip into first and second opposing jaws integrally formed with the elongate body, the jaws being adapted to move between an open and a closed configuration;

    the jaws having an outside diameter delimiting an interior space when the jaws are in the closed configuration, the space being in communication with the open inner lumen; and

    at least one distally extending sample guide prong in the cutting tip, the at least one guide prong being contained within the outside diameter when the jaws are in the closed configuration.
